SCAMwatch has recently received complaints from consumers who have been sent unsolicited text … An unsolicited text message is sent to your mobile phone telling you that you have won an unexpected prize. The message asks you to respond with an email address where details of your win can be sent. The email will lead to requests for personal details including information about your bank accounts…

…Text messages are also commonly used by scammers to send competition or prize scams. Scammers often try to snare many people with one SMS sent en masse - this is known as spamming. Scammers may request personal details or payments in scam SMS messages.
